1. 理解MyBatis-Plus的多条件排序功能 MyBatis-Plus提供了灵活的排序功能,允许根据多个字段进行排序。这可以通过QueryWrapper或LambdaQueryWrapper来实现,这些包装器类提供了多种排序方法,如orderByAsc、orderByDesc以及更灵活的orderBy方法。 2. 编写多条件排序的代码示例 以下是一个使用QueryWrapper进行多条件排序的示例:...
第一种: queryWrapper.orderByAsc("sort_code"); 这种方式仅支持单个固定字段,固定排序方式排序,而且order by 在分页计算total就已经加上了,效率多少是有些影响的 (select count(*) from table order by ) 第二种 通过baomidou.page 自带的 ascs[],desc[]数组,page.setAscs(),page.setDescs() 注入,就只...
import bw.yth.svc.base.AppConst;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.extension.plugins.pagination.Page; /** 查询相关的工具类 */ public class QueryUtil { /** 防SQL注入过滤。去掉 “'";\”及空格 * @return - 输入为空或全被过滤...
queryWrapper.orderByAsc("sort_code"); 这种方式仅支持单个固定字段,固定排序方式排序,而且order by 在分页计算total就已经加上了,效率多少是有些影响的 (select count(*) from table order by ) 第二种 通过baomidou.page 自带的 ascs[],desc[]数组,page.setAscs(),page.setDescs() 注入,就只会在查询...
orderBy方法用于设置排序字段,可以同时设置多个字段按照优先级排序。示例代码如下: javaCopy codeimport com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; import com.baomidou.mybatisplus.core.enums.SqlKeyword; import com.baomidou.mybatisplus.core.toolkit.StringUtils; ...
mybatis plus 多字段排序 , Task::getBeginTime, Task::getCreateTime));
博主打算从0-1讲解下java进阶篇教学,今天教学第九篇:MyBatis-Plus用法介绍。 在MyBatis-Plus 3.5.0 中,LambdaQueryWrapper支持多种条件构造方式,除了等于(eq)、不等于(ne)、大于(gt)、小于(lt)、大于等于(ge)、小于等于(le)等基本的条件构造方式外,还包括模糊查询(like)、模糊查询不匹配值(notLike)、在列表...
1. 组装查询条件 @SpringBootTest public class MyBatisPlusWrapperTest { @Autowired private UserMapper userMapper; @Test public void test01(){ //查询用户名包含a,年龄在20到30之间,邮箱信息不为null的用户信息 //SELECT uid AS id,user_name AS name,age,email,is_deleted FROM t_user WHERE is_delet...
mybatis-plus:global-config:#设置逻辑已删除的状态为1logic-delete-value: 1#设置逻辑未删除的状态为0logic-not-delete-value: 0 条件构造器Wapper: 组装查询条件: @Testpublic void test(){//查询用户名包含张,年龄在20到30之间,邮箱信息不为null的用户信息QueryWrapper<User> queryWrapper=new QueryWrapper<User...
mybaties如何按照指定的顺序排列 mybatis plus排序,需求背景:一个审核流程。审核人等级分为市级和省级,管理员升级字段adminlevel,字段含义:1省级,2市级。审核字段audit为int字段,字段含义:1待市级审核,2待省级审核,3通过审核。需求:不管市级还是省级,都需要将待